×
Register Here to Apply for Jobs or Post Jobs. X

Senior Mobile Developer; React Native

Remote / Online - Candidates ideally in
Montreal, Montréal, Province de Québec, Canada
Listing for: Medfar
Full Time, Remote/Work from Home position
Listed on 2026-03-13
Job specializations:
  • Software Development
    Full Stack Developer, Software Engineer, App Developer - Mobile/Web
Job Description & How to Apply Below
Position: Senior Mobile Developer (React Native)
Location: Montreal

Job Description

As a Senior Mobile Developer, you will play a key role in designing, building, and maintaining high-quality cross-platform mobile applications that deliver exceptional user experiences. You’ll collaborate with product, design, and backend teams to bring intuitive, performant features to life on iOS, Android, and web using React Native.

You bring deep technical expertise, a strong sense of ownership, and a mentoring mindset that raises the bar for the entire team. You combine hands-on development with architectural thinking to ensure every product we ship is stable, scalable, and delightful to use.

What you'll do:

As a Senior Mobile Developer, you will go beyond building features. You will help shape the foundation of our mobile ecosystem and the standards that guide how we deliver quality software. Specifically, you will:

  • Architect for Scale:
    Design and evolve robust, maintainable, and secure mobile application architectures that perform seamlessly across platforms.

  • Own the Build and Release Process:
    Manage the full lifecycle of mobile releases, including builds, signing, certificates, versioning, and deployments to app stores.

  • Handle Stores and Publishing:
    Configure and maintain app store accounts, certificates, and credentials. Oversee publishing workflows and ensure timely, compliant releases.

  • Champion Quality and Standards:
    Write clean, testable, and performant code. Uphold best practices in accessibility, maintainability, and performance optimization.

  • Enhance Workflows:
    Improve build automation, testing pipelines, and release management processes to streamline delivery and reduce risk.

  • Collaborate Across Disciplines:
    Work closely with Product Managers, Designers, and Backend Developers to deliver cohesive, user-focused experiences.

  • Mentor and Guide:
    Support peers through code reviews, pair programming, and architectural discussions. Encourage curiosity and technical growth across the team.

  • Drive Technical Innovation:
    Explore new tools and frameworks that improve scalability, developer experience, and long-term product health.

Qualifications

What You Bring

  • University degree in computer science, software engineering, or a related field.

  • At least 10 years of experience in mobile development, including extensive experience with React Native for cross-platform applications.

  • Proven ability to architect and deploy large-scale mobile systems integrated with backend and cloud services (Azure experience is a plus).

  • Deep understanding of mobile build systems, certificates, signing, and app publishing for both iOS and Android.

  • Experience managing store releases, versioning, and CI/CD automation for mobile delivery.

  • Experience integrating RESTful or Graph

    QL APIs, native modules, and third-party libraries

  • Strong knowledge of mobile performance optimization, debugging, and security best practices.

  • Hands-on experience improving Dev Ops, testing, and deployment workflows in mobile environments.

  • Excellent communication and collaboration skills in cross-functional agile teams.

  • A natural mentor who supports others through guidance and knowledge sharing.

  • Fluency in English and French (spoken and written).

Working conditions:

  • Contract:
    Permanent, full time (40h/week)

  • Working mode:
    Hybrid or Remote

    • Occasional in-office presence may be required during the year (for events or team meetings, for example).

    • Candidates must reside in the province of Quebec.

Additional Information

By joining MEDFAR, you will be part of a purpose-driven organization whose product is disrupting and digitizing health care, making doctors’ and healthcare workers’ lives easier, while enabling better patient health outcomes. Becoming a MEDFARian also means having the opportunity to be part of an innovative community and working in a dynamic environment where your work will have a meaningful and tangible effect not only on your team and the business but most importantly on the healthcare industry.

  • Remote work and flexibility (supporting work-life balance)

  • RRSP contribution

  • Healthcare insurance from day one

  • Paid time off: 3 weeks + 1 additional week between Christmas and New Year

  • Annual training allowance ($1,500) to support your professional development

  • An o…

Position Requirements
10+ Years work experience
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ary